About The Opportunity

An exciting opportunity exists to lead the fast paced and dynamic chromatography and mass spectrometry laboratories in the department of Chemical Pathology at Royal Prince Alfred Hospital. The position will involve method development and validation of new pathology tests as well as continued service delivery of established tests. Additional responsibilities include operational supervision of the trace elements and porphyrin laboratories and ensuring that laboratory accreditation requirements are fulfilled.

What You'll Be Doing

Responsible for the management of scientific, technical and support staff, all testing and associated activities and logistics for the assigned laboratory. The position oversees the quality, cost and operational integrity of the department, regulatory compliance and accreditation of laboratory services in the department, human resource, business and resource management.

Occupational Assessment, Screening and Vaccination Against Specified Infectious Diseases

This is a Category A position. All Category A applicants must read and understands NSW Health Policy Directive PD2024_015 Occupational Assessment, Screening and Vaccination Against Specified Infectious Diseases. All recruits must agree to comply with the requirements outlined in this policy. All recruits must provide evidence against specified diseases and comply with the requirements of this policy at their own cost prior to appointment.
